I use Enhance-Hunters Edge. Dogs look real good on it and seem to have no bottom. I'm feeding 2 cups with a handful of raw meat and a vitamin per day. In the winter I'll kick that up to 3-4 cups per day with the meat/vitamin and sometimes cook up a mess of elk and deer liver in a crock pot. They get a nice warm meal for a couple of days.

Check out a website called dogfoodanalysis.com
They have every dog food I have ever heard of, and many I never knew existed listed on there. You can search the site and find certain foods.

They rank the dog foods from 1-6 STARS and break down the labels/ingredients telling you whats good and bad about them. Check it out and see where your dog food ranks. I found out I was feeding some food with questionable ingredients and switched.

I also found the foods in the 5 and 6 STAR level were way to spendy for my budget, feeding a pack of dogs. It would not be that bad if you were only feeding one dog.

I know there is more to nutrition than how many cups you feed/ what the turds look like/ and what kind of shape the mutts are in. Cancer has been linked to certain ingredients and poor quality food.
